    Bridging the Gaps Inc Substance Abuse and Outpatient ServsCARF AccreditedSAMHSA

    drug treatment facility - Bridging the Gaps Inc VA
    31 South Braddock Street
    Winchester, VA. 22601
    540-535-1111

    Bridging the Gaps Inc is 11.1 miles from Gore, Virginia

    Bridging The Gaps in Winchester, VA is an integrative addiction treatment center providing quality, compassionate, and comprehensive care for adults in need of substance abuse treatment. We offer residential and outpatient programs for adults that are abusing drugs and alcohol.
